Storage in Big Data Market Growth Accelerates With Cloud AI and Advanced Data Management

Market Overview

The Storage in Big Data Market is becoming increasingly important as organizations generate, collect, and analyze massive volumes of structured and unstructured information. According to Market Research Future, the market was valued at USD 7.9 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 31.09 billion by 2035, expanding at a CAGR of 13.26% during 2025–2035. The growth reflects rising demand for scalable infrastructure capable of supporting cloud applications, artificial intelligence, machine learning, Internet of Things environments, and advanced analytics. Modern enterprises require storage systems that provide high availability, flexibility, security, and rapid data access while controlling infrastructure complexity. Cloud-based storage, hybrid architectures, and intelligent data management are therefore becoming central to enterprise technology strategies. As businesses increasingly treat data as a strategic asset, efficient storage infrastructure is essential for converting large datasets into useful insights, improving operational efficiency, and supporting digital transformation across industries.

Key Market Drivers and Emerging Trends

The expansion of data generation is one of the strongest drivers shaping the Storage in Big Data Market. Organizations across finance, healthcare, telecommunications, manufacturing, transportation, and media continuously generate information through transactions, connected devices, applications, sensors, and digital platforms. This environment creates demand for storage systems that can scale without compromising accessibility or performance. Cloud storage adoption is another major trend because it allows organizations to expand capacity while reducing dependence on traditional physical infrastructure. Hybrid storage models are also gaining attention by combining on-premises resources with cloud environments, helping enterprises balance performance, security, flexibility, and cost. Artificial intelligence is further transforming data management by supporting automated classification, intelligent retrieval, optimization, and analytics. According to Market Research Future, cloud storage adoption, hybrid storage solutions, and AI-driven data management are among the prominent trends influencing the industry.

Segmentation and Industry Applications

The Storage in Big Data Market can be analyzed according to components and industry verticals. The component segment includes hardware, software, and services. Hardware remains an important foundation because enterprises need high-capacity storage drives, servers, and supporting infrastructure to manage large datasets. Meanwhile, software is gaining importance as organizations seek better data management, analytics integration, automation, and cloud-based capabilities. Services are also becoming valuable as businesses require consulting, maintenance, managed storage, and optimization support. By vertical, the market covers banking, financial services and insurance, information technology and telecommunications, healthcare, manufacturing, transportation, media and entertainment, and other sectors. BFSI represents a major application area because financial organizations manage extensive transactional and customer data while facing strict security and compliance requirements. Healthcare is also becoming a significant growth area as electronic health records, medical imaging, connected devices, and analytics increase the need for secure and accessible storage infrastructure.

Regional Outlook and Competitive Landscape

Regional adoption of big data storage technologies varies according to digital infrastructure, cloud maturity, regulatory requirements, and enterprise technology investment. North America currently leads the market, supported by strong technology infrastructure, widespread cloud adoption, and demand for advanced analytics. Europe is also an important market, where data protection requirements and digital transformation initiatives encourage organizations to adopt secure and compliant storage solutions. Asia-Pacific represents a rapidly developing opportunity because increasing internet penetration, cloud adoption, smart-city initiatives, and IoT deployment are creating substantial volumes of digital information. Countries such as China and India are contributing to regional growth through expanding digital ecosystems. The competitive landscape includes major technology companies such as Amazon Web Services, Microsoft, Google, IBM, Oracle, Dell Technologies, Hewlett Packard Enterprise, Alibaba Cloud, and SAP. Companies are focusing on product development, scalable architectures, AI integration, cloud capabilities, and data-management innovation to strengthen their positions.

Future Opportunities and Outlook

The future of the Storage in Big Data Market will be closely connected with artificial intelligence, cloud computing, edge processing, cybersecurity, and advanced analytics. As AI workloads become more data-intensive, organizations will need storage architectures capable of supporting high-performance processing and large-scale datasets. Edge computing can create additional opportunities by enabling data to be processed and stored closer to connected devices, reducing latency for real-time applications. AI-driven storage management can also improve resource utilization, data accessibility, and operational efficiency. Security will remain a priority as organizations store increasingly sensitive business, financial, healthcare, and customer information. Market Research Future identifies hybrid cloud storage, AI-driven data management, and edge computing storage as important future opportunities. With the market projected to reach USD 31.09 billion by 2035, continued investment in flexible and intelligent storage infrastructure is expected to support digital transformation across multiple industries.
